SAN MATEO, Calif., Feb. 09, 2017 -- Coupa Software (NASDAQ:COUP), a leader in cloud-based spend management, will report its financial results for its fourth quarter and fiscal year ended January 31, 2017, after market close on Monday, March 13, 2017.
Coupa will host a conference call for analysts and investors at 5:00 p.m. Eastern time on that day. The news release with the financial results will be accessible at the Coupa investor relations website (http://investors.coupa.com) prior to the conference call.

About Coupa Software
Coupa Software (NASDAQ:COUP) is the cloud platform for business spend. We deliver “Value as a Service” by helping our customers maximize their spend under management, achieve significant cost savings and drive profitability. Coupa provides a unified, cloud-based spend management platform that connects hundreds of organizations representing the Americas, EMEA, and APAC with millions of suppliers globally. The Coupa platform provides greater visibility into and control over how companies spend money. Customers – small, medium and large – have used the Coupa platform to bring billions of dollars in cumulative spend under management. Learn more at www.coupa.com.
